Well, if you're gonna quote acceleration times, could you put up the 1/4
mile ET & trap speeds?

Also, 0-150 mph times for either car would be awesome...

Someone said it well that a true measure of supercar acceleration is to be
able to hit 150 mph in 20 seconds or less...you'd be surprised how many
"fast" cars cannot do this.

0-60 is almost meaningless to me, because you can take two cars with
identical 0-60s that have very different real world acceleration
abilities...

Also, what's the consensus of the F50's true weight? It's no secret that
Ferrari likes to underquote weight..2700-2800 lbs might be on the lighter
side of things for the F50.
